N-(4‘-chlorobenzyl)-4-(chloroacetyl)pyridinium chloride was prepared from the N-(4‘-chlorobenzyl)-4-acetylpyridinium chloride by chlorination with sulfuryl chloride. This chloro ketone had a half life of 150 min at pH 7.3 and reacted specifically with thiols.
